    Iran is Exploiting UK’s Small Boats Crisis to Smuggle Intelligent Agents Into Britain * The Gateway Pundit * by Ben Kew

    Iran is exploiting illegal migrant routes across the English Channel to infiltrate Britain with intelligence operatives, according to a report by The Telegraph.

    The newspaper reports that British authorities have disrupted multiple attempts by individuals linked to Iran’s Ministry of Intelligence and Security (MOIS) to enter the UK by posing as illegal migrants crossing the Channel in small boats.

    According to The Telegraph, the Home Office detected and blocked some of the suspected operatives using surveillance drones, watchtowers, and facial recognition technology deployed along the south coast.

    The report raises fresh concerns over the national security implications of Britain’s ongoing small boats crisis.

    More than 30,000 Iranian nationals are believed to have reached the UK via illegal Channel crossings, although it remains unclear how many suspected intelligence operatives may have entered successfully.

    The Telegraph also reports that additional individuals linked to Iran’s Islamic Revolutionary Guard Corps (IRGC) are believed to have entered Britain through conventional air travel.

    An unnamed Iranian official told the newspaper that Tehran’s security apparatus exerts influence over many of the people-smuggling networks used by migrants attempting to reach Europe.

    “These smuggling routes are more important and useful than the missiles for us,” the official reportedly said. “We do not need a missile to target London. It’s easier than that.”

    The source also claimed Iran already has “revolutionary people” in London awaiting instructions and warned that the regime could “easily make London unsafe” if it chose to do so.

    The revelations come amid growing concerns over Iranian activity inside the UK amid their ongoing conflict with the United States.

    British security services have repeatedly warned of an increase in Iran-backed assassination plots, surveillance operations and other hostile state activity targeting individuals on British soil.

    Reform UK leader Nigel Farage has previously warned that Iran would exploit Britain’s open borders.

    Speaking earlier this year, he said a source within the Iranian-Persian community had told him that Iranian operatives were already crossing the English Channel in small boats.

    “To put that in simple terms, we are importing terrorists into our country from across the English Channel,” Farage said.
